// Publishes the built npm packages from build/packages
// 1. Show checklist (automate later)
// 2. Prompt to ensure build is complete
// 3. Prompt for dist-tag?
'use strict';
const path = require('path');
const semver = require('semver');
const glob = require('glob');
module.exports = function(vorpal, app) {
vorpal
.command('npm-publish')
.description('Update the version of React, useful while publishing')
.action(function(args) {
return new Promise((resolve, reject) => {
const currentVersion = app.getReactVersion();
const isStable = semver.prerelease(currentVersion) === null;
this.log(`Preparing to publish v${currentVersion}…`);
if (isStable) {
this.log(`"latest" dist-tag will be added to this version`);
}
// TODO: show checklist
this.prompt([
{
type: 'confirm',
message: 'Did you run `grunt build` or `grunt release` and bump the version number?',
name: 'checklist',
},
]).then((answers) => {
if (!answers.checklist) {
return reject('Complete the build process first');
}
// We'll grab all the tarballs and publish those directly. This
// is how we've historically done it, though in the past it was
// just npm publish pkg1.tgz && npm publish pkg2.tgz. This
// avoided the need to cd and publish.
const tgz = glob.sync('build/packages/*.tgz', {
cwd: app.PATH_TO_REPO,
});
// Just in case they didn't actually prep this.
// TODO: verify packages?
if (tgz.length === 0) {
reject('No built packages found');
}
// TODO: track success
tgz.forEach((file) => {
this.log(app.execInRepo(`npm publish ${file} --tag=next`));
});
if (isStable) {
tgz.forEach((file) => {
const pkg = path.parse(file).name;
this.log(app.execInRepo(`npm dist-tag add ${pkg}@${currentVersion} latest`));
});
}
resolve();
});
});
});
};
